Abstract
Choosing the appropriate materials for the friction pairs in a swashplate axial piston hydraulic pump fully lubricated with seawater is very important in order to overcome the problems related to corrosion, friction and wear. Many different types of materials including engineering ceramics such as zirconia, silicon nitride, engineering polymer composites polyetheretherketone, and corrosion-resistant alloys like bronze, stainless steel were investigated by means of tribological experiment. The experimental results are analyzed. The optimum matching of materials for the main friction pairs in the pump were determined based on the experiment results which exhibited satisfying anti-wear capability in a seawater hydraulic pump.
